How Commercial Furnace Systems Work
A commercial furnace system heats air and moves it through a building using ducts. It uses parts like a heat exchanger, blower motor, and thermostat controls.
These systems are much larger than home units. They must heat multiple floors and large spaces. This makes them more complex.

Common Problems in Large Building Furnaces
Uneven Heating Across Floors
One common issue is uneven heating. Some rooms may feel warm, while others stay cold.
This often happens due to poor airflow or duct problems. A blocked or leaking HVAC duct system can cause this issue.
System Not Producing Enough Heat
Sometimes the furnace runs, but it does not produce enough heat. This can happen if the burner system is not working properly.
It may also be due to worn-out parts or incorrect settings. In colder areas like Minnesota, this problem becomes more noticeable.
Strange Noises or Frequent Shutdowns
Unusual noises like banging or rattling are warning signs. These sounds often point to loose parts or motor issues.
Frequent shutdowns can also signal problems with the thermostat or safety controls. These issues should not be ignored.
When Do You Need Furnace Repair in Large Buildings?
Warning Signs to Watch For
There are several signs that your system needs repair:
- Rising energy bills
- Poor airflow in certain areas
- Unusual smells or noises
- Frequent system cycling
These signs show that your heating system is not working efficiently.
